(4-Chlorophenyl)boronic acid Use and Manufacturing

suzuki reaction 4-Chlorobenzeneboronic Acid is used as a catalyst for the preparation of 4-hydroxycoumarin derivatives which display antitrypanosomal and antioxidant properties. It is also used as a catalyst for the asymmetric borane reduction of electron-deficient ketones.

Computed Properties

Molecular Weight:156.38
Hydrogen Bond Donor Count:2
Hydrogen Bond Acceptor Count:2
Rotatable Bond Count:1
Exact Mass:156.0149373
Monoisotopic Mass:156.0149373
Topological Polar Surface Area:40.5
Heavy Atom Count:10
Complexity:102
Covalently-Bonded Unit Count:1
Compound Is Canonicalized:Yes
